Inattentiveness ADHD can be detected if you find it difficult to focus on a task or stay focused during a conversation. Your mind may wander, or you may struggle to follow instructions that are complex, resulting in mistakes at work, and in relationships with family and friends. It is also easy to become distracted by extraneous stimuli such as social media or television or your own thoughts. You might also easily forget appointments, forget deadlines or lose important paperwork or documents. Everybody loses things from time-to-time However, if you frequently lose your keys or run out of money or forget to take your medication, you could be suffering from inattention ADHD symptoms. These symptoms can cause serious issues in your daily life, such as missing appointments, loss of earnings and financial problems. They can also make you appear rude and selfish to those around you. Adults with inattentive ADHD are often not diagnosed because hyperactivity is not typical in this subtype. This kind of ADHD typically manifests in the early years of childhood. However, for some people, it may be hidden until adulthood, and not identified until their 40s, or even 50s.
